Skip to main content

Shepherd

Project description

Picovoice Shepherd

Made in Vancouver, Canada by Picovoice

Picovoice Shepherd is the first no-code platform for building voice interfaces on microcontrollers. It enables creating voice experiences similar to Alexa that run entirely on microcontrollers. Picovoice Shepherd accelerates prototyping, mitigates technical risks, and shortens time to market. Paired with Picovoice Console users can deploy custom voice models into microcontrollers instantly.

Compatibility

  • Linux (x86_64)
  • macOS (x86_64)
  • Windows (x86_64)

Installation

Install the Picovoice Shepherd:

pip3 install pvshepherd

Note for macOS

Install Python using either the official installer or Homebrew. Shepherd cannot run using the Python shipped with macOS. If using the Homebrew Python, make sure that /usr/local/bin is in the PATH variable before installing Shepherd.

Note for Windows

The default Python installation options do not add it to the Windows PATH variable. To fix the issue, refer to this link.

Usage

Run the following command from the terminal:

pvshepherd

On Linux, Shepherd will ask for the root password only on the first launch.

For more information, please refer to Picovoice Shepherd Documentation

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

pvshepherd-0.8.9.tar.gz (60.0 MB view details)

Uploaded Source

Built Distribution

pvshepherd-0.8.9-py3-none-any.whl (60.8 MB view details)

Uploaded Python 3

File details

Details for the file pvshepherd-0.8.9.tar.gz.

File metadata

  • Download URL: pvshepherd-0.8.9.tar.gz
  • Upload date:
  • Size: 60.0 MB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.3.0 pkginfo/1.7.0 requests/2.25.1 setuptools/52.0.0 requests-toolbelt/0.9.1 tqdm/4.56.0 CPython/3.8.5

File hashes

Hashes for pvshepherd-0.8.9.tar.gz
Algorithm Hash digest
SHA256 b60396bd99f92b2ff0079a6beafb3364f7301673548f31e4cf8acea71587d059
MD5 f4cdd20d51b68742b1a4af9b0ec5a02e
BLAKE2b-256 88d7c176fa8dfa52849f222c1572f914a06bc9f5e21820742d470cc8293f4b9b

See more details on using hashes here.

File details

Details for the file pvshepherd-0.8.9-py3-none-any.whl.

File metadata

  • Download URL: pvshepherd-0.8.9-py3-none-any.whl
  • Upload date:
  • Size: 60.8 MB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/3.3.0 pkginfo/1.7.0 requests/2.25.1 setuptools/52.0.0 requests-toolbelt/0.9.1 tqdm/4.56.0 CPython/3.8.5

File hashes

Hashes for pvshepherd-0.8.9-py3-none-any.whl
Algorithm Hash digest
SHA256 de11953c61dffcdbe89e9a0dd21c231f4555d329e977f5d65c96f3cbd4983ee6
MD5 3630ede2e1a2742b7690cb4025a0e42c
BLAKE2b-256 ee3a449f7ef4b1f5900f2a64198c2f882597ed05f4cb3b3f2c5b4e50e1824419

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page